**Q: What happens when Mailcull marks a bounce as permanent?**

Mailcull, our email bounce processor, classifies hard bounces after three consecutive failures and suppresses the address automatically. Soft bounces are retried for 72 hours. If the suppression list itself becomes corrupted, restore it from the encrypted nightly snapshot in the Thornfield backup bucket. Restoring requires the team recovery passphrase, which is kept directly below this entry for emergencies.

unlock words, kahof-bahap: praax-ulaix

Subject: On-call briefing — bakery order cutoff

Hi, and welcome to the Crumbline on-call rotation. The most common page you'll see involves the order-cutoff rule: storefronts stop accepting next-day orders at 16:00 local bakery time, and the scheduler enforces this server-side. If a merchant claims orders slipped past cutoff, check the scheduler log before assuming a bug — daylight-saving transitions cause most false alarms. Escalate only if the enforcement timestamp itself is wrong. The full triage flowchart lives on our internal page.

dashboard of bafof-hafog = https://confluence.lumiclabs.internal/display/browse/display/6a09a20a

## Runbook: Vexlint release

On page: check the Vexlint pipeline on the Droswell runner. If the docs lint stage is red, rerun once; twice-failed means a rule regression — revert the last ruleset commit. Do not skip lint to unblock docs publishes. After revert, rebuild, confirm green, then push the hotfix tag. The tag must be signed before the registry accepts it, using the key below.

deploy key for kajof-yawif: bky9_fvxrpdHPq